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(196)

Side by Side Diff: components/invalidation/impl/BUILD.gn

Issue 2130453004: [Sync] Move //sync to //components/sync. (Closed) Base URL: https://chromium.googlesource.com/chromium/src.git@master
Patch Set: Rebase. Created 4 years, 4 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
« no previous file with comments | « components/invalidation.gypi ('k') | components/invalidation/impl/android/DEPS » ('j') | no next file with comments »
Toggle Intra-line Diffs ('i') |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
OLDNEW
1 # Copyright 2014 The Chromium Authors. All rights reserved. 1 # Copyright 2014 The Chromium Authors. All rights reserved.
2 # Use of this source code is governed by a BSD-style license that can be 2 # Use of this source code is governed by a BSD-style license that can be
3 # found in the LICENSE file. 3 # found in the LICENSE file.
4 4
5 if (is_android) { 5 if (is_android) {
6 import("//build/config/android/rules.gni") 6 import("//build/config/android/rules.gni")
7 } 7 }
8 8
9 static_library("impl") { 9 static_library("impl") {
10 sources = [ 10 sources = [
(...skipping 189 matching lines...) Expand 10 before | Expand all | Expand 10 after
200 "p2p_invalidation_service.h", 200 "p2p_invalidation_service.h",
201 ] 201 ]
202 } 202 }
203 } 203 }
204 204
205 if (is_android) { 205 if (is_android) {
206 android_library("java") { 206 android_library("java") {
207 deps = [ 207 deps = [
208 ":proto_java", 208 ":proto_java",
209 "//base:base_java", 209 "//base:base_java",
210 "//sync/android:sync_java", 210 "//components/sync/android:sync_java",
211 "//third_party/android_protobuf:protobuf_nano_javalib", 211 "//third_party/android_protobuf:protobuf_nano_javalib",
212 "//third_party/cacheinvalidation:cacheinvalidation_javalib", 212 "//third_party/cacheinvalidation:cacheinvalidation_javalib",
213 "//third_party/cacheinvalidation:cacheinvalidation_proto_java", 213 "//third_party/cacheinvalidation:cacheinvalidation_proto_java",
214 "//third_party/jsr-305:jsr_305_javalib", 214 "//third_party/jsr-305:jsr_305_javalib",
215 ] 215 ]
216 java_files = [ 216 java_files = [
217 "android/java/src/org/chromium/components/invalidation/InvalidationClientS ervice.java", 217 "android/java/src/org/chromium/components/invalidation/InvalidationClientS ervice.java",
218 "android/java/src/org/chromium/components/invalidation/InvalidationService .java", 218 "android/java/src/org/chromium/components/invalidation/InvalidationService .java",
219 "android/java/src/org/chromium/components/invalidation/PendingInvalidation .java", 219 "android/java/src/org/chromium/components/invalidation/PendingInvalidation .java",
220 ] 220 ]
221 } 221 }
222 proto_java_library("proto_java") { 222 proto_java_library("proto_java") {
223 proto_path = "android/proto" 223 proto_path = "android/proto"
224 sources = [ 224 sources = [
225 "$proto_path/serialized_invalidation.proto", 225 "$proto_path/serialized_invalidation.proto",
226 ] 226 ]
227 } 227 }
228 android_library("javatests") { 228 android_library("javatests") {
229 deps = [ 229 deps = [
230 ":java", 230 ":java",
231 "//base:base_java", 231 "//base:base_java",
232 "//base:base_java_test_support", 232 "//base:base_java_test_support",
233 "//sync/android:sync_java", 233 "//components/sync/android:sync_java",
234 "//third_party/cacheinvalidation:cacheinvalidation_javalib", 234 "//third_party/cacheinvalidation:cacheinvalidation_javalib",
235 "//third_party/cacheinvalidation:cacheinvalidation_proto_java", 235 "//third_party/cacheinvalidation:cacheinvalidation_proto_java",
236 ] 236 ]
237 java_files = [ 237 java_files = [
238 "android/javatests/src/org/chromium/components/invalidation/InvalidationCl ientServiceTest.java", 238 "android/javatests/src/org/chromium/components/invalidation/InvalidationCl ientServiceTest.java",
239 "android/javatests/src/org/chromium/components/invalidation/TestableInvali dationClientService.java", 239 "android/javatests/src/org/chromium/components/invalidation/TestableInvali dationClientService.java",
240 ] 240 ]
241 } 241 }
242 junit_binary("components_invalidation_impl_junit_tests") { 242 junit_binary("components_invalidation_impl_junit_tests") {
243 java_files = [ "android/junit/src/org/chromium/components/invalidation/Pendi ngInvalidationTest.java" ] 243 java_files = [ "android/junit/src/org/chromium/components/invalidation/Pendi ngInvalidationTest.java" ]
244 deps = [ 244 deps = [
245 ":java", 245 ":java",
246 "//base:base_java", 246 "//base:base_java",
247 "//base:base_java_test_support", 247 "//base:base_java_test_support",
248 ] 248 ]
249 } 249 }
250 generate_jni("jni_headers") { 250 generate_jni("jni_headers") {
251 sources = [ 251 sources = [
252 "android/java/src/org/chromium/components/invalidation/InvalidationService .java", 252 "android/java/src/org/chromium/components/invalidation/InvalidationService .java",
253 ] 253 ]
254 jni_package = "components/invalidation" 254 jni_package = "components/invalidation"
255 } 255 }
256 } 256 }
OLDNEW
« no previous file with comments | « components/invalidation.gypi ('k') | components/invalidation/impl/android/DEPS »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698